How does Mayfield, KY compare to Middletown, KY? Mayfield has a population of 9,905 with a median household income of $41,458, while Middletown has 9,622 residents and a median income of $74,129.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Mayfield, KY | Middletown, KY |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 9,905 | 9,622 | +2.9% |
| Median Age | 37.1 | 43.9 | -15.5% |
| Foreign Born % | 6.5% | 9.7% | -33.0% |
| Metric | Mayfield | Middletown |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$41,458 | $74,129 | -44.1% |
| Unemployment | 4.2% | 5.7% | -26.3% |
| Poverty Rate | 30.7% | 11.7% | +162.4% |
| Bachelor's+ | 22% | 50.5% | -56.4% |
| Metric | Mayfield | Middletown |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$114,400 | $298,900 | -61.7% |
| Median Rent | $598/mo | $1423/mo | -58.0% |
| Housing Units | 5,059 | 4,766 | +6.1% |
